Functional linguistics has explored the question of how communicative functions are reflected in the use of language. In this line of research, the present study attempts to characterize you know, which has been treated as a discourse marker, by investigating its communicative functions in conversation in terms of stance-taking and engagement from the perspectives of discoursepragmatic, interactional linguistics and systemic functional linguistics. This research starts with the assumption that conversation is basically a joint action between speaker and hearer in attaining equilibrium in sharing information about states or events being talked about. Based on this assumption, this study examines American English conversations, claiming that you know is a speaker-oriented stance marker which is closely related to the speaker’s attitudes in dealing with knowledge or information states of the objects or events being discussed. Second, this research shows that interactional functions of you know can be summarized as in the following: (i) seeking confirmation, (ii) getting attention, (iii) stalling for word search, (iv) indicating repair, and (v) providing additional information. In sum, this research shows that the functions of you know can be better characterized in interactional contexts in terms of stance-taking and engagement in the process of sharing information.
